What is Blow Molding?
Blow molding is the process by which hollow plastic parts are formed. It is a process used to produce hollow objects from thermoplastic.  

The basic process has two parts. First, a preform (or parison) of hot plastic resin in a somewhat tubular shape is created. Second, a pressurized gas, usually air, is used to expand the hot preform and press it against a mold cavity. The pressure is held until the plastic cools. Once the plastic has cooled and hardened the mold opens up and the part is ejected.
